Dr. Ibrahim Haddad serves as Head of Infotainment at Volvo Cars, where he leads the development of next-generation infotainment systems that enhance the driving experience through seamless connectivity, advanced user interfaces, and intelligent in-vehicle technologies. Prior to joining Volvo Cars, Dr. Haddad served as Vice President of Strategic Programs at the Linux Foundation, where he led LF AI & Data as its Executive Director. In this role, he worked with leading technology companies and open-source communities to foster a vendor-neutral platform for advancing open-source AI. Under his leadership, the foundation grew to 69 projects with over 100,000 active developers from 3,000+ organizations worldwide, providing a trusted hub for developers to build and scale AI-driven solutions.

As the founding Executive Director of the PyTorch Foundation, he collaborated with key industry players, including AMD, AWS, Google Cloud, Meta, Microsoft, and NVIDIA, to expand the PyTorch ecosystem. He oversaw all aspects of the foundation’s operations, including financial management, ecosystem growth, and community engagement, significantly increasing its adoption and industry impact within 18 months.

Before joining the Linux Foundation, he was Vice President of R&D and Founder & Head of the Open Source Division at Samsung Electronics in Silicon Valley. There, he developed Samsung’s open-source strategy, launched collaborative R&D initiatives, and played a key role in M&A and corporate VC efforts via SamsungNEXT. He also represented Samsung in numerous open-source foundations and industry consortia, driving partnerships and governance frameworks for large-scale collaborative projects.

Earlier in his career, Dr. Haddad held key technology and portfolio management roles at Ericsson Research, Open Source Development Labs, Motorola, Palm, and Hewlett-Packard. He has extensive experience scaling engineering teams across North America, Europe, and Asia, bridging technology and business to drive efficiency and competitive advantage.He holds a Ph.D. in Computer Science with Honors from Concordia University (Montréal, Canada) and is fluent in Arabic, English, and French.
